One basic argument for intermediate sanctions is that ______________, as traditionally practiced, is inadequate for a large number of criminal offenders. ​

One basic argument for intermediate sanctions is that probation, as traditionally practiced, is inadequate for a large number of criminal offenders. ​Probation in criminal law is a period of supervision over an offender, ordered by the court instead of serving time in prison
